Answer:

Credibility and precision of his results.

Explanation:

By using so many plants, Mendel made sure that his results were credible and that his genetic trait ratios between the plants were consistent and precise.  Using a large number of subjects reduces the chances of having outliers in the data set.

True or False. In pernicious anemia, oxygen depletion in the body becomes apparent withing the first 6 months of life.
mylen [45]

False, pernicious anemia may take up to 5 years to show symptoms. However, the oxygen starts to get depleted within the first 6 months in thalassemia major.

Pernicious anemia:

In this condition, the body is unable to absorb vitamin B12 which leads to lowered amount of red blood cells which are responsible for carrying oxygen throughout the body. It is an autoimmune disease in which antibodies attack their own cells in the lining of the stomach which affects the absorption of vitamin B12. The symptoms of pernicious anemia are dizziness, fatigue, diarrhea, constipation, breathlessness, and loss of appetite. The depletion of oxygen is seen in thalassemia major within 6 months.
